In the realm of Tamil devotional music, few songs capture the serene beauty and profound grace of Lord Murugan as evocatively as "Thiruparankundrathil Nee Sirithal." This timeless hymn, which praises the deity at the sacred Thiruparankundram hill temple, has become a staple for millions of devotees.
